Everything You Should Know Before Moving to Portales, NM

Thinking of moving to Portales, NM? With a friendly population of 11,754 and a median home value around $143,000, Portales offers affordable living, short 14-minute commutes, and sunny weather nearly three-quarters of the year. The city is home to Eastern New Mexico University, and families enjoy local schools and a cost of living well below the national average. While property crime is a bit higher than average, the tight-knit community, reasonable rents, and small-town charm make Portales a welcoming place to call home.

Is Portales, NM a safe place to live?

While Portales experiences a slightly higher property crime rate, with a 1 in 49 chance, violent crime remains moderate at 1 in 262. Residents benefit from a tight-knit community that supports local safety initiatives, although newcomers should remain aware of property security.

What is the weather like in Portales, NM year-round?

Portales enjoys a sunny climate, with 72% of days filled with sunshine and average annual rainfall of 17.5 inches. Winters are mild with lows around 21°F, while summers are warm but not extreme, making outdoor activities enjoyable much of the year.

What is the housing market like in Portales, NM?

Portales offers affordable housing, with a median home price of $143,000 and an owner-occupied rate of 61%. The rental market is accessible, with average two-bedroom rents at $760 and a low foreclosure rate, making it appealing for both buyers and renters.
